#921018 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#921018 is composed of 57.3% red, 6.3%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 356.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 31.8%. #921018 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2030 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#921018 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#921018 has RGB values of R:146, G:16,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.84,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9572376.

Shades and Tints of #921018
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fef2f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#921018
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544e4f is the less saturated color, while #9e040d is the most saturated one.
